[Watch] Dewald Brevis Hits 3 Consecutive No-Look Sixes Against Australian Pacer During AUS vs SA Decider T20I
Dewald Brevis smashes 53 off 26 balls in 3rd T20I vs Australia, continuing hot form after his maiden international hundred.
Dewald Brevis is enjoying the form of his life. After blasting a match-winning century in the second T20I, the young South African star followed it up with another fiery knock in the series decider against Australia.
Batting first, South Africa were 114 for 4 in 12.2 overs when Brevis departed. The 22-year-old hammered 53 runs off just 26 balls, striking one four and six towering sixes at a strike rate above 200.
His fearless hitting gave South Africa a strong push after a shaky start. Skipper Aiden Markram fell early, and Ryan Rickelton and Lhuan-dre Pretorius could not carry on after promising starts. Brevis, however, took charge and kept the run rate soaring.
Nathan Ellis eventually dismissed him for 53, but by then the damage was done. Brevis walked back to a loud ovation, having once again lifted his side in a high-pressure clash.
Meanwhile, during his stay in the middle, he played some outstanding shots, including three consecutive no-looks sixes, which he hit against Aaron Hardie. While the fourth ball was adjudged wide, Brevis on the very next ball hit another six.

Brevis Shines Back-to-Back
Just two days ago, Brevis smashed his maiden T20I hundred, an unbeaten 125 against the same opposition. That knock helped South Africa level the series 1-1 after losing the first match.
Now, in the decider, he has kept the momentum going with yet another standout performance. Whether South Africa can convert his efforts into a series win will depend on how the rest of the batters and bowlers respond in the second innings.
